What to plant in April in Emilia-Romagna
April in Emilia-Romagna is a month rich in spring options: 14 crops are recommended across most municipalities analyzed, including Swiss chard, Broccoli, Carrot, Tuscan kale, Onion, and 9 more crops. 12 are region-wide; the others are still recommended in most municipalities. The municipality page remains the reference for precise dates, frost, heat, dry spells, and local windows.

Method and harvest timing
- Direct sowing: Swiss chard, Carrot, Potato, Pea, Radish, Arugula, Spinach, Parsley
- Transplanting: Broccoli, Strawberry, Sage
- Multiple methods: Tuscan kale, Onion, Lettuce
- Closest harvests: Arugula (from April 25 to May 24), Radish (from April 25 to May 24), Lettuce (from May 5 to June 3), Spinach (from May 5 to June 3), Swiss chard (from May 20 to June 18), and 5 more
- Later harvests: Sage (from June 21 to June 28), Onion (from June 29 to July 28), Potato (from July 14 to July 28), Parsley (from July 11 to July 18)
